Here's the Monday Blues Map #187 map. This map continues from last week's map. This is the western half of the ground level map. Click to enlarge.



Here's how last week's and this week's maps fit together. Click to enlarge.



Map Details:
  • Grid Size: 42x62 10’ Squares or 84x124 5’ Squares (72 dpi); VTT Size: 1261x1611
  • The double white lines on the buildings' exteriors walls are windows. The towers of areas 8 and 19 have arrowslits.
  • Areas 1 and 11 have vegetation/trees. I'm picturing area 11 to be apple orchards (or any fruit bearing tree depending on the location's climate).
  • Area 2 is a wooden bridge.
  • Area 3 is the surrounding water (that is at a lower elevation than the land areas).
  • Outside area 4 (to the south), 13 a), and outside 13 b) are ladders to the upper level.
  • Areas 6, 8, 12 a), and 17 have trap doors in their ceilings. There are ladders (not shown on map) at these locations to allow access to the trap doors.
  • Areas 9 and 14 have wells.
  • Just north of area 10 are a series of hitch posts for horses.
  • There are ceremonial pillars at the front of the paths through area 11.
  • Area 13 a) is a stable. Area 13 b) is a small side building.
